“Because right now, it feels like there’s a loophole where records can be used against someone, but never disclosed to them.”

Your request doesn’t really present this issue. Under the CAO’s appeal decision (which differs materially from the analysis of the records officer decision you discuss in the body of your post), the records are classified as private. That means you can’t obtain another person’s personnel file.
But GRAMA permits a government entity to disclose a private record to the subject of the record. UCA 63G-2-202(1)(a)(i).

We’re converting our parking strip. What do we need to know before we start? by zellazilla in SaltLakeCity

[–]BangCrashPow 18 points19 points  (0 children)

Call blue stakes before you make any plans. We have a gas line that runs the entire length of our park strip, so any digging or trenching for water lines, etc. must be done by hand. Might impact your irrigation and planting plans.

E: and by “call blue stakes” I mean make a locate request on their website. But 40 years of marketing permanently implanted that phrase in my brain.

Playoff Tickets by Space__Cowboy22 in Utah_Hockey

[–]BangCrashPow 1 point2 points  (0 children)

They have to pay everybody but the players, somewhat ironically. NHL players only receive salary for regular season games. The league provides a bonus pool that is divided among the playoff teams (largely in proportion to how far the team advances) but the total bonus pool for 2025-26 is $24 million. Individual players thus tend to receive a fraction of their regular-season per-game salary, especially if their series run long.

Has anybody heard if he's starting in Tucson or helping the main club with the playoff push? by Agitated_Victory0315 in Utah_Hockey

[–]BangCrashPow 2 points3 points  (0 children)

The 2025 MOU commits the NHL to reopening its agreement with the CHL to modify the mandatory return rule for 19 year olds, with a goal of modifying the rule to allow each club to loan one 19 year old player to the AHL without first offering to return them to their CHL club. The NHL and CHL were "nearing an agreement" three days ago, but it does not appear to be a done deal yet.

"Trade him for Robert Thomas!!!" by sourdoughrrmc in Utah_Hockey

[–]BangCrashPow 6 points7 points  (0 children)

The team cannot "bring up" a player from a CHL team during the season. Players returned to their junior team cannot be recalled or otherwise return to the NHL team until their junior team is out of contention for the season. Kelowna has 4 more regular season games to play and has clinched a playoff spot, so will remain in contention through early April at least.

New thin-line rain barrels available in the U.S. (easy free shipping to SLC from Walmart) by ProfessorHike in SaltLakeCity

[–]BangCrashPow 4 points5 points  (0 children)

Anybody can collect rainwater with up to two storage containers, up to 100 gallons each, per property. A person who registers with the state engineer can use containers totaling up to 2,500 gallons. This is governed by Utah Code 73-3-1.5.

Jury Duty by oldmccollum in SaltLakeCity

[–]BangCrashPow 16 points17 points  (0 children)

Sending out a questionnaire to potential jurors is the first step in jury selection for both state and municipal courts, so that is, in general, how jury pools are selected. If you aren’t comfortable filing out and mailing the form, you can complete the questionnaire online instead.
